There's company called "The Next Up" (Home | The Next UpThe Next Up). <br /><br />They offer a great solution to the issues you are having and more importantly allows the salespeople to manage their time better. They can explain it better, so I'll try to do it quickly, the system monitors the floor traffic and alerts the salespeople when it their turn to grab the next up. Because the system secures a salesperson opportunity to get an up it allows the salespeople to make calls and do other tasks as they wait for "The Next Up". For some reason the dealerships I worked at put the BDC at the back of the showroom with no windows, so time sent in there cost you floor traffic. Do you make calls or sit near a window to watch for the up bus? I demo'ed the product some time ago and thought it was an awesome idea and it would have relieved all the problems with trying to grab ups or all the salespeople racing to the shopper's vehicle and jumping on the hood to claim the up. The system also provides real accountability for the floor up traffic the dealership receives and sees which salespeople are going through ups at an alarming rate without closing deals. Some salespeople "pre-qualify" the ups and decide to turn them loose without following the road to the sale and you'll be surprised with who burns through tons of ups. First of all image of t...I agree with article 100%. First of all image of the dealership is very important. No body want's to see 10-20 guys standing outside in a huddle smoking cigarettes. Let's look another statistic according to J.D. Power study car salesman work only about 1.5 hours out of 10 hour shift. If your dealership has 10 guys that's 80 hours of brain power wasted in a day. That's lots of wasted time. As a sales guy if your are thinking fresh 'ups" is the only way to go then you are wrong. If you are in for long haul you should be more focused on repeat and referrals because you can make more money from those customers and they are easy to sell it to. The dealer group I work for it has couple of dealerships on store has 30+ sales people and they sell about 450-500 cars for month and second store has about 6-7 salespeople and they sell 50-80 cars per month. Both stores are using Sky Up System. It's an electronic "Up" system. As a salesperson I love it because I never miss a "fresh Up" cuz when me turn is coming up i get a text on my phone, I have all the time to do whatever I want. Managers love it cuz they don't have to worry about having bunch of guys standing outside making the dealership look bad and scare away customers.
